Gluten is a grain protein that is responsible for giving dough its flexibility. You will find it in breads, cakes, crackers, pies, and many other food items. Some people have a sensitivity to grain proteins and should avoid these things. Not long ago, they would need to forgo many common foods that are tasty and enjoyable.

If you have sensitivity to grain protein you may become ill after ingesting it. This is known as celiac disease, and it can cause one to have diarrhea and gas. One also may experience stomach upsets and cramping. In fact, it can interfere with the body's ability to properly absorb nutrients.

The best treatment for celiac disorder is to avoid foods that one is sensitive to. Thankfully, there are many good products on the market that are safe for sensitive individuals to consume. You can find some excellent foods like bread, cupcakes, and brownies.

Most special bread products are found frozen in the store and they are easy to defrost and enjoy. It is best not to defrost the entire loaf, but just the slices that you plan to eat. You may find these products more desirable if they are toasted, as it improves their texture.
